CC   -!- FUNCTION: Required for the proteolytic cleavage of the transcription
CC       factor pacC in response to alkaline ambient pH. Might be a pH sensor.
CC       {ECO:0000269|PubMed:7830727}.
CC   -!- SUBCELLULAR LOCATION: Cell membrane; Multi-pass membrane protein.
CC   -!- SIMILARITY: Belongs to the palH/RIM21 family. {ECO:0000305}.
